## How Do You Choose the Right eLearning Content Software?

### What You Should Know About eLearning Content Software

### eLearning content software buying insights at a glance&nbsp;

[eLearning content](https://www.g2.com/categories/elearning-content)software helps organizations deliver structured training through digital courses, modules, and learning assets that employees can access on demand across devices. These platforms typically support course libraries, custom content, multimedia formats, assessments, and progress tracking so teams can standardize training, support different roles or skill levels, and scale learning across onboarding, compliance, and upskilling programs.

As workforce skills evolve quickly, many organizations now treat eLearning content solutions as a core enablement system rather than an optional learning perk. Buyers increasingly evaluate top eLearning content providers based on how quickly teams can deploy training, how engaging the learning experience feels for employees, and how easily the platform integrates with [LMS](https://www.g2.com/categories/learning-management-system-lms), [HR](https://www.g2.com/categories/hr), and enablement tools already in place. That’s why the most widely adopted eLearning content providers focus on usability, quick implementation, and broad course coverage that supports both technical and professional skill development across departments.

Across G2 reviews, the data reflect how strongly buyers value accessibility and ease of adoption. The average star rating is 4.59 out of 5, with an average likelihood to recommend score of 9.19 out of 10. Ease scores trend high as well: 6.46 out of 7 for ease of use and 6.42 out of 7 for ease of setup, suggesting that organizations prioritize eLearning content software that can be deployed quickly without heavy administrative overhead. Support is another consistent strength, with quality of support averaging 6.49 out of 7. Notably, about 20.7% of reviewers report switching from another solution, which I often interpret as teams moving from ad-hoc training resources to more structured eLearning content solutions that are easier to manage, report on, and scale across the business.

Organizations use learning platforms to standardize onboarding and ramp training so new hires can reach productivity faster, while also managing compliance training by assigning recurring requirements and tracking completion for audits. They also support role-based upskilling and technical training by mapping content to job families and helping teams stay current with evolving tools, skills, and best practices, while enabling managers to scale leadership development without building internal curricula.

Most **eLearning content solutions** are priced as annual licenses, typically based on seats or active learners, with tiers that change access to libraries, analytics, and admin controls. Many **eLearning content providers** also package content by audience (e.g., technical vs. general) or offer enterprise agreements for company-wide rollouts. Free trials are common, but the real cost driver is usually scale (number of learners) plus reporting and governance needs.

### eLearning Software FAQs

#### **How do you plan an eLearning content strategy?**

Start by defining the business outcomes the training should support, such as onboarding speed, compliance readiness, or technical skill development. From there, map role-based learning paths instead of relying on a broad course catalog. Most teams combine multiple content formats—microlearning modules, interactive labs, and video courses—and integrate the content platform with their [LMS](https://www.g2.com/categories/learning-management-system-lms) or HR system for tracking. Successful strategies also include ongoing measurement of engagement, completion rates, and skill improvements to continuously refine the learning program.

#### **What are the three main types of eLearning?**

The three most common types of eLearning are self-paced learning, instructor-led virtual training (VILT), and blended learning. Self-paced learning allows employees to complete courses independently using videos, quizzes, and interactive modules. VILT delivers training through live online sessions with instructors and peer interaction. Blended learning combines both formats, pairing self-paced courses with workshops or live instruction to reinforce knowledge and practical application.
